What problem does it solve?
Content creation for narratives often suffers from inconsistent quality and disjointed workflows. This Skill unifies four writing pipelines (derived, new, revise, cascade) under QTSP quality gates to ensure consistent, high-quality output across channels.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Unified pipelines: seamless orchestration of derived, new, revise, and cascade workflows.
- QTSP quality gates ensure structured evaluation at key points in the editing cycle.
- Agent-assisted drafting and interviewing to surface real material and close narrative gaps.
- Channel-aware output with automated content loading from content.json and contextual tone guidance.
Real-world example: A marketing blog post is drafted via the "new" pipeline, then revised to meet QTSP criteria, with a short interview to fill any narrative gaps before finalization.
